Types of taps

The variety of models and designs that can be found in the faucet market is increasingly wide. Not only with regard to the form or system they use, but also as regards the materials used or the services they offer.

Currently, the taif considered traditional is one that uses a system of mechanical water activation. That is, one or two handles that open and close the water outlet. Until recently, the flow and hot water could not be regulated, but nowadays, thanks to systems such as EcoNature and ColdOpen of Clever taps, we can easily reduce the jet by up to 50% and prevent hot water from leaving in the central position of the handle. With both we can save a huge amount of water.

With the continuous advances in technology, in addition to installing mechanical faucets, we also have the option of thermostatic faucets. These, instead of a handle, work with a system of self-regulation of temperature and flow. Their main advantage is that they are able to block the passage of water when another tap is opened. In this way we avoid possible burns.

How to install faucets in our home

When it comes time to install faucets in our home, we must know that there are different possibilities. Before deciding on a system, pay attention to the installation of the pipes. Unless it is a new work in which we can decide where to place it or a comprehensive reform, we must respect the existing location.

That said, let’s see below the places where it is possible to install faucets in our bathroom and kitchen.

Wall or built-in taps

Although sometimes some distinction can be made between the two terms for the pieces of the faucet, after all it is the same system. This consists of installing faucets embedded in a wall. Thus, the faucet will protrude horizontally from the wall, and the water outlet will be inside the sink, sink, etc.

This type of faucets that drain the flow directly from the wall have regained momentum in recent years. It is a facility that used to be used in the past. We usually find them in those bathrooms and kitchens that look for an attractive and innovative design, but with a vintage touch.

The advantages of installing faucets on the wall are aesthetics and space saving. As we have said, they recall an earlier era, and that is why they are ideal when we want to play with traditional aesthetics and innovation. As for the space, since they come directly from the wall, the wash shelf or the sink is completely clear.

The disadvantage is that we mentioned above, and is that if we want to go from taps d shelf to install faucets on the wall, if we have coating, will have to remove it to install the pipe.

Countertop taps

The shelf faucet is the most common and the one that has a simpler installation. Being the most common trend, we can replace one tap for another without any inconvenience. However, if we choose to install shelf faucets, we can choose from a wider variety of models and designs. Thus, we find the single-lever, bimand and electronic faucets. Another advantage of installing shelf faucets, besides the range of options, is the savings in the installation.
